Enzymes accelerate, or catalyze, chemical reactions, and they are known to catalyze more than 5,000 biochemical reaction types. Most enzymes are proteins, although a few are catalytic RNA molecules. Choose specific enzymes for cleaving bonds, removing genomic DNA from RNA preparations, for producing fragments of proteins, or for use in ion exchange chromatography. Enzymes are used in the chemical industry and other industrial applications when extremely specific catalysts are required.

Sheep Hyaluronidase (from Testes), MP Biomedicals
Supplier: MP Biomedicals
Hyaluronidase is a glycoprotein containing 5% mannose and 2,17% glucosamine, it catalyzes the random hydrolysis of 1,4-linkages between 2-acetamido- 2-deoxy- b-D-glucose and D-glucose residues in hyaluronate. It is a tetramer consisting of 4 equal subunits with a molecular mass of 14 kDa each.

Chicken lysozyme (from egg white), MP Biomedicals
Supplier: MP Biomedicals
Lysozyme (muramidase) hydrolyses preferentially the β-1,4 glucosidic linkages between N-acetylmuramic acid and N-acetylglucosamine which occur in the mucopeptide cell wall structure of certain microorganisms, such as Micrococcus lysodeikticus.

Tritirachium album proteinase K, MP Biomedicals
Supplier: MP Biomedicals
Suitable for both protein and nucleic acid isolation. Exhibits proteolytic activity on proteins, peptides, glycoproteins, amides and esters. Also active with nitroanilides of amino acids with protected amino groups, excluding arginine. Useful in the isolation of DNA and RNA, in the analysis of membrane structures and protein structure. Proteolytic activity: >30mAnson Units/mg Unit definition: One Anson unit is the amount of enzyme which liberates 1 µmol of Folin-positive amino acids per minute at pH 7,5 and 35 °C, using hemoglobin as substrate.

Papain, MP Biomedicals
Supplier: MP Biomedicals
Activators: Papain is activated by cysteine, sulphide, sulphite and more. It is enhanced when heavy metal binding agents such as EDTA are also present. N-bromosuccinimide enhances the activity. Inhibitors: Substances which react with sulphydryl groups including heavy metals, carbonyl reagents. Aldehydes are papain inhibitors. Benzoylamidoacetonitrile is an inhibitor. See Shapira and Arnon (1967a and b) on antibody inhibitors. Papain may be inactivated by H₂O₂ generated by γ-irradiation of H₂O− the active SH group being oxidised to sulphenic acid. Specific inhibitors are AEBSF, antipain, cystatin, E-64, leupeptin, PMSF, TLCK and TPCK.

Bovine deoxyribonuclease I (from Pancreas), MP Biomedicals
Supplier: MP Biomedicals
Deoxyribonuclease from beef pancreas, DNase I, was first crystallized by Kunitz. It is an endonuclease which splits phosphodiester linkages, preferentially adjacent to a pyrimidine nucleotide yielding 5'-phosphate terminated polynucleotides with a free hydroxyl group on position 3'. The average chain of limit digest is a tetranucleotide. DNase I acts upon single chain DNA, and upon double-stranded DNA and chromatin.

Bovine alpha-Chymotripsin (from Pancreas), MP Biomedicals
Supplier: MP Biomedicals
Preparation Method
Produced from 3× crystallised chymotrypsinogen
α-Chymotrypsin is used for treating pancreatic insufficiency and in traumatology.
Chymotrypsin preferentially catalyses the hydrolysis of peptide bonds involving L-isomers of tyrosine, phenylalanine, and tryptophan. It also readily acts upon amides and esters of susceptible amino acids. In addition to bonds involving aromatic amino acids, chymotrypsin catalyses at a high rate the hydrolysis of bonds of leucyl, methionyl, asparaginyl, and glutamyl residues. a-Chymotrypsin is a protein consisting of 241 amino acid residues. The molecule has three peptide chains: an A chain of 13 residues, a B chain of 131 residues, and a C chain of 97 residues.
